Summary
The resolution asks the Department of Community Affairs to continue using the 2015 International Energy Conservation Code rather than adopting the 2024 edition. It contends that the newer code would add thousands of dollars to construction costs, pushing more residents out of the housing market. The measure is intended to help keep homes affordable amid rising building expenses.
